i have a Associated 12L4 and durring the day the car is awsome but whe the sun goes down the car gets really loose to the level of when i turn the wheel just a little the car spins out. the car is basically stock but i did put the CRC lowerd pods on. my set up is the green spring on the center shock, white stuff on the dampiner plate, .63 T-plate, 10 deg. blocks in the front with th carbon fiber bace between them, the reactive caster set in the middle meaning a white shim on either side and .020 springs in the front i'm running 4mm ride hieght and Jaco double raps purbles in the front and double pinks in the rear the front is cut to 1.70 and rear at 1.80. what would be a good change to make to get the car not to spin out.
